Supports Object Evolution

As a database ages and designs change, database objects may need to change too. FreeForm OODB accommodates this with object evolution. Object evolution allows database objects to grow in size.

Without object evolution, adding a data member to a storable object class would render objects of that class (previously stored in a database container) useless. In other words, you would be unable to retrieve them from the database. You would also be unable to overwrite objects previously stored in the database. Setting the correct parameter allows you to save and retrieve objects even if the object class has increased in size.

An object oriented database is not useless without this ability. But is certainly makes it difficult to deploy an oodb application and then provide upgrades to that application.
